Sat 1858634684038592

decimal
663815.309038592
degree
0°33815′551″309038592‴
percentile
88.50641362300433%
name
arkudlqbmjx
cycle
0
epoch
3
period
329
block
663815
offset
309038592
timestamp
rarity
common
inscriptions
location
6c6f0c5ddd1ec39749f1df7dd8d2e966652564ecdcf3f99cdda8f59187a112b4:1:111481741
address
32WSk67w8Pc1ha2vH9gCcRjfQytDeXDpNa